2nd victim of Palermo fire found dead
A person’s body has been recovered after a fire tore through a Palermo building Monday night, injuring one other man. The fire broke out about 11:25 p.m. at the Leeman Arm Road home, according to Shannon Moss, a spokesperson for the Maine Department of Public Safety.
